Common challenges when choosing between eSignature and CRM lead management

  • Fragmented data: leads split across signature tools and CRM records create reconciliation work.
  • Workflow mismatch: signature-centric flows often lack native pipeline stages required by sales teams.
  • Integration complexity: mapping fields and triggers between systems can require middleware.
  • Compliance tasks: applying consistent retention and audit settings across platforms is time consuming.

Key features to evaluate in signNow's lead management vs OnePage CRM

Assess these core capabilities when deciding between signNow and OnePage CRM; each affects lead flow, compliance, and the effort required to maintain synchronized records across tools.

Embedded Signing

Ability to host signing experiences within a web page or app, reducing friction for leads and keeping the user on your site during contract execution while capturing contextual metadata.

Template Management

Support for reusable document templates with mapped fields, allowing consistent document preparation, faster send times, and lower risk of missing critical contract information in lead workflows.

Field Mapping

Automatic transfer of form or document field values into CRM contact and lead records, minimizing manual data entry and improving data consistency across systems.

Workflow Automation

Triggers and rules that advance lead stages, send reminders, or create follow-up tasks after signatures are collected, enabling predictable lead progression and reduced manual work.

API & Webhooks

Programmatic endpoints and event notifications for real-time synchronization, enabling custom integrations that keep CRM pipelines current when documents are signed.

Compliance Controls

Features like audit trails, signer authentication options, and configurable retention policies that help meet ESIGN and UETA requirements and support internal governance.

Industry examples of combining eSignature and lead workflows

Two brief case examples show how an eSignature-first approach and a CRM-first approach handle lead capture and contract completion in practical settings.

Real Estate Broker

A brokerage captures lead details via a listing inquiry form and sends listing agreements for signature using an embedded eSignature flow

  • Rapid signature collection reduces fall-through rates
  • Signed contracts auto-create client records in CRM

Leading to faster onboarding and fewer manual entry errors, ensuring timely commission processing.

Small B2B Software Vendor

The vendor tracks leads in OnePage CRM and uses integrated eSignatures for purchase orders

  • CRM manages follow-up tasks and next actions
  • Signed orders update deal stages and trigger provisioning

Resulting in reduced time-to-fulfillment and clearer sales accountability for support teams.
